Why These Pumpkin Spice Macarons Work Perfectly Every Time

The secret lies in precise measurements and proper technique. Almond flour creates the signature chewy texture while pumpkin puree adds moisture without compromising structure.

Temperature control ensures perfect shells. Room temperature egg whites whip better, creating stable peaks. The spice blend balances sweetness with warmth.

Aging the batter develops flavors. This professional technique improves texture and taste significantly.

What You’ll Need for Perfect Pumpkin Spice Macarons

Ingredients

CategoryIngredientsQuantity & Notes
BaseAlmond flour, powdered sugar1 cup (100g), 2 cups (240g)
MeringueEgg whites, granulated sugar3 large (100g), 1/4 cup (50g)
FlavorPumpkin puree, vanilla extract1/4 cup (65g), 1 tsp
SpicesCinnamon, nutmeg, ginger1 tsp, 1/2 tsp, 1/4 tsp

Tools

CategoryToolsPurpose
MixingStand mixer, large bowl, rubber spatulaWhip meringue, fold batter
PreparationFine mesh sieve, kitchen scaleSift flour, measure precisely
BakingPiping bag, parchment paper, baking sheetsShape and bake macarons

How to Make Pumpkin Spice Almond Macarons

PhaseStepsTime & Key Points
PrepPreheat oven to 300°F, line baking sheets, sift dry ingredients10 minutes – Room temperature eggs
MeringueBeat egg whites until frothy, add sugar gradually to stiff peaks5-7 minutes – Don’t overbeat
MacaronageFold almond mixture, add pumpkin and spices, mix until flowing3-5 minutes – Ribbon consistency
BakePipe circles, tap sheets, rest 15 minutes, bake until set15-18 minutes – No wiggle test

The macaronage technique requires patience. Fold ingredients gently to maintain air bubbles. The batter should flow like thick ribbon when lifted.

Resting before baking creates the signature “feet.” This step prevents cracking and ensures smooth tops.

Mistakes to Avoid While Making Pumpkin Spice Macarons

Overmixing destroys meringue structure. Stop folding when batter flows smoothly. Undermixing creates lumpy, cracked shells.

Skipping the sifting step causes uneven texture. Always sift almond flour and powdered sugar together twice for smoothness.

Opening oven door during baking causes temperature drops. This leads to collapsed or cracked macarons. Trust the timing and visual cues.

Using old baking powder or expired spices affects flavor. Fresh spices make noticeable differences in taste quality.

! 🧭 Need to Know

  • Humidity affects macaron success – avoid baking on rainy days when possible
  • Pumpkin puree must be thick – drain excess moisture with paper towels first
  • Macarons taste better after 24 hours as flavors meld and texture improves

FAQs:


Can I make pumpkin spice macarons without almond flour?

No, almond flour is essential for authentic macaron texture. Substitutes won’t produce the same results or characteristic chewy consistency.


How long do pumpkin spice macarons stay fresh?

Properly stored macarons last one week at room temperature. Freeze filled macarons for up to three months in airtight containers.


Why did my pumpkin spice macarons crack on top?

Cracking usually results from too-high oven temperature or insufficient resting time. Always rest piped macarons 15-30 minutes before baking.


Can I use fresh pumpkin instead of puree?

Yes, but roast and puree fresh pumpkin first. Remove excess moisture by straining through cheesecloth for best results.


What's the best filling for pumpkin spice macarons?

Cream cheese buttercream, caramel ganache, or spiced white chocolate ganache complement the pumpkin spice flavors perfectly.

Pumpkin Spice Macarons

Delicate French macarons infused with warm pumpkin spice flavors, featuring smooth shells and a perfectly balanced filling with autumn spices.

  • Total Time: 48 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up (100g) almond flour
  • 2 cups (240g) powdered sugar
  • 3 large (100g) egg whites
  • 1/4 cup (50g) gran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up (65g) pumpkin puree
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/2 tsp nutmeg
  • 1/4 tsp ginger

Instructions

  1. Prep: Preheat oven to 300°F, line baking sheets, sift dry ingredients (10 minutes – Room temperature eggs)
  2. Meringue: Beat egg whites until frothy, add sugar gradually to stiff peaks (5-7 minutes – Don’t overbeat)
  3. Macaronage: Fold almond mixture, add pumpkin and spices, mix until flowing (3-5 minutes – Ribbon consistency)
  4. Bake: Pipe circles, tap sheets, rest 15 minutes, bake until set (15-18 minutes – No wiggle test)

Notes

  • Use aged egg whites left at room temperature overnight for better volume and stability
  • Test oven temperature with thermometer as accuracy is crucial for proper shell development
  • The macaronage technique requires patience – fold gently to maintain air bubbles for perfect texture
  • Resting before baking creates the signature “feet” and prevents cracking for smooth tops
